我有一个包含许多活动的应用程序,共享相同的菜单,这是在代码模块中创建的。此菜单有一个“退出”选项。如何在不使用ExitApplication的情况下完成所有正在运行的活动?我是否必须在代码模块中创建一个变量(ExitNow为boolean)并在每个活动的每个Activity_Resume中检查它?
答案 0 :(得分:1)
将activity.finish作为退出按钮的代码
答案 1 :(得分:1)
试试这个。
Intent intent = new Intent(getApplicationContext(), Home.class);
intent.addFlags(Intent.FLAG_ACTIVITY_CLEAR_TOP);
startActivity(intent);
答案 2 :(得分:1)
在prossec global中输入:
Dim GExit as boolean
Gexit= false
在此代码的所有活动中输入所有简历:
if Gexit = true then activity.finish
并在BTNEXIT中输入此代码:
Gexit= true
activity.finish
答案 3 :(得分:0)
我尝试了很多例子,但这对我很有用
Intent intent = new Intent(getApplicationContext(), HomeActivity.class);
intent.addFlags(Intent.FLAG_ACTIVITY_CLEAR_TASK|Intent.FLAG_ACTIVITY_NEW_TASK);
startActivity(intent);